The Sun Hydraulics KFR (Material Number: KFR) is a line mount manifold designed for hydraulic systems, featuring a ninety-degree configuration with a gauge port for efficient fluid control and monitoring. It is constructed from 6061T651 aluminum, known for its robust corrosion resistance and cost-effectiveness. The manifold includes two M10x1.5 6H metric mounting holes with a depth of 15.7 mm, ensuring secure installation. It accommodates one open cavity, specifically the T19A cavity type, and features a port size of 1 12 Code 61. This design is particularly suitable for high-flow valve applications due to its standard line mount interface and durable construction. Users should note that while the aluminum material offers excellent durability, it is not rated for system pressures exceeding 3000 psi (210 bar). Notes:
  • Important: Carefully consider the maximum system pressure. The pressure rating of the manifold is dependent on the manifold material, with the port type/size a secondary consideration. Manifolds constructed of aluminum are not rated for pressures higher than 3000 psi (210 bar), regardless of the port type/size specified.
